#d60c4d h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#d60c4d is composed of 83.9% red, 4.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 64%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 340.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#d60c4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ff189a with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0103 is the darkest color, while #fff6f9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766c6f is the less saturated color, while #df034a is the most saturated one.

Below, you can see how #d60c4d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y

  • #505050 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6b424f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population

Dichromacy

  • #757374 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8b6f4a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d62a28 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population

Trichromacy

  • #984d65 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a64b4b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d61f35 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
